Royal Enfield Interceptor 750 Series 2, 1970 setting a tickover after attending to carburettors.
Переглядів 2,2 тис.19 годин тому
After finding - and clearing a blocked pilot passageway in the left hand carburettor and fitting o rings where they had been absent on both carburettor flanges, I balanced and synchronized the throttle cable and slides. I also adjusted the choke cables so the choke slides lifted fully when raised. After that, as seen here, I needed to achieve a steady, even tickover and that process can be seen...

BSA A65 engine strip and rebuild 3 Discussing the gearbox condition and changing some ratios.
Переглядів 1,5 тис.21 годину тому
Going into the gearbox and changing some of the gears to alter some ratios and do away with some worn original parts. Reference to some parts lists was a big help here, as two pairs of gears are interchangeable on the shafts and getting them wrong could give rise to much fun and games!

Simple ways of adapting hardware shop tools and engine pushrods for cylinder head porting duties.
Переглядів 1,9 тис.День тому
I know long reach deburring tools can occasionally be found, but I find it is much easier to get hold of the shorter ones, although they have limited reach for cylinder head porting work, as do the abrasive flap wheels which are also very useful. Here, I show the simple methods I use to extend them so they can reach further into those tricky areas deep inside the ports of cylinder heads.
